Shelter
Providing a safe, comfortable place to sleep every night of the year, IPH's five year-round and seasonal emergency shelters offer guests a place to rest, recharge, and take steps to reach their goals.
Community Connections
Our community-based services create welcoming, accessible spaces where neighbors experiencing or at-risk of homelessness can meet immediate needs while working toward long-term goals. Over time our Community Connections service pillar has grown to include our Albany-based drop-in center, health and wellness services, the Fulton County Street Outreach Program, and the Albany Ambassadors Employment Initiative, filling the gaps and creating opportunities for every neighbor to thrive.
Housing
With over 100 housing units spanning Albany, Fulton, Montgomery, and Saratoga Counties, IPH Housing provides long-term solutions for individuals and families leaving homelessness. Throughout each household's time in our Housing, tenants work with IPH to address challenges - like apartment care, emotional wellbeing, and transportation - before these small issues begin to threaten their housing.
